Born out of discussion, reflection and prayer, Lazaretto responds to the needs of those in aged care and hospital ministry – residents and patients; families, carers and loved ones; pastoral ministers, support workers, chaplains and practitioners.

Lazaretto’s primary purpose is to support those in residential aged care and people who are experiencing sickness or ill-health in hospital. This includes spiritual formation and professional learning opportunities in ministry and theology to support workers and practitioners in the field. Also key to the ministry at Lazaretto is the ongoing care and support for families and carers who are journeying alongside their loved ones.

The team at Lazaretto are practical and pastoral ministers who draw on their own experiences through life and service in aged care and hospital settings to provide you with the resources and formation you need.

Lazaretto is a rich combination of readily available resources for individual and facilitated group prayer, rituals and reflection, as well as engaging in-person formation opportunities for chaplains, support workers, and healthcare practitioners.
